IN RE ZIDEK

No. 8520.

143 F.2d 592 (1944)

In re ZIDEK. STROBL v. ZIDEK.

Circuit Court of Appeals, Seventh Circuit.

June 21, 1944.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Samuel Strobl, of Chicago, Ill., pro se.

Arthur Chittick, of Chicago, Ill., for appellee.

Before EVANS, SPARKS, and KERNER, Circuit Judges.


PER CURIAM.

Appellant has appealed from an order entered December 31, 1943, denying appellant's motion, filed, December 7, 1943, to clarify an order made, November 18, 1932. This order denied a previously entered order discharging the debtor, who had been adjudged bankrupt, from his debts.
